My new to me 1987, 4.0 turns over but will not start. The previous care taker, who I trust completely, was a mechanic for 30 years and is now a pastor. He said it was running until about a week before I came to pick it up. He was the father-in-law of my good friend who died about a year and a half ago. The widow offered me the truck a few months back, but I only recently went to pick it up. Anyway, The fuel pump is getting juice but the power to it drops after a second of two. The fuel pump isn't functioning but I am not sure if it is the pump, the relay, or something else. This is my first fuel injected project, so please bear with me. Any help would be appreciated.

I was comparing specs of the Comanche to a new 2 door Tacoma. The bed on the Tacoma is 1/2 inch wider and .2 inches shorter than a short bed Comanche. This made me think a cap for a new Tacoma might mount up to a short bed Comanche. Has anyone tried this? Edit: Never mind, I was looking at exterior box width. The Tacoma is 1.4 inches wider as far as cargo area goes. I was just looking for options.
